Output dd3cda08655ab2660a4922dfde6eec249762df4a37bb5ae433b7f0f8c04b065a:0

value
17371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e906ad30ab4dff9ecd17d0714d54318f70481c OP_EQUAL
address
34h2hcoxXMpMq1s4XgjXPCyoeqNP1qKYbH
transaction
dd3cda08655ab2660a4922dfde6eec249762df4a37bb5ae433b7f0f8c04b065a
spent
true